“Ali Baba” launches “the first global artificial intelligence” to detect stomach cancer

The “Ali Baba” group has revealed the world’s first artificial intelligence model capable of diagnosing stomach cancer, even in its early stages, using CT scans only without the need for surgical procedures.

This innovation goes beyond the need for disturbing and painful internal theorizing, which often discourages patients from early examination.

The developed system is known as Grape (an abbreviation of “stomach cancer risk assessment”), a cooperation fruit between Ali Baba Academy and Zhejiang Cancer Hospital.

The model was based on a huge clinical study that included about 100,000 participants from 20 hospitals in China, which helped training the system to get to know accurate patterns that even specialized doctors may lose. Thus, Grape became able to determine the signs of stomach cancer in high -resolution of radiology, achieving an sensitivity rate of 85.1% and accuracy of 96.8% in clinical trials.

In some cases, the model monitored tumors that doctors were unable to notice, which could provide patients for months of delay in treatment.

In China, less than 30% of patients are undergoing internal endoscopy tests, according to Dr. Cheng Xiang Dong of Zhejiang Hospital, due to its exhausting nature. So, the Grape model offers a comfortable, comfortable solution based on photography, which is a qualitative shift in the discovery of this deadly disease.

Currently, the system is being prepared for adoption in the provinces of Zhejiang and Annai, with a previous success of the Damo Academy with the “Damo Panda” tool, which was used to discover pancreatic cancer and obtained a classification of the “innovative device” from the American Food and Drug Administration in 2023.

Ali Baba, in cooperation with the World Health Organization, is also working to spread these technical solutions in low -income areas to improve early detection opportunities and reduce the gap in health care.
